Our Team
Optimized Process Designs, LLC (OPD) is an engineering/construction company headquartered in Katy, TX with an expertise in the natural gas, natural gas liquids, and petrochemical industries. OPD is part of the larger Koch Engineered Solutions (KES) organization which provides a variety of capabilities across many industries. Originally incorporated in 1980, OPD has developed a strong reputation for honesty, integrity, and ability to successfully execute projects. OPD has a key advantage in being able to supply construction services as well as engineering/procurement. This enables clients to have a ''one stop shop'' for the overall project, providing increased efficiency and avoiding potential interface problems. OPD's industry experience, flexibility, and personal attention have made us a preferred partner to our customers and our tight knit, highly productive, team atmosphere makes OPD a great place to work.
What You Will Do
Assist Precision Millwrights with inspecting, moving, assembling, and setting equipment such as turbines, pumps, motors, Fin Fans, cooling towers, compressors into position
Read blueprints, isometric drawings, schematics, and engineering specifications.
Able to use industrial hand tools and power tools including but not limited to grinders, lathes, torque wrenches, band saws, chain falls, come-alongs, wrenches, and porta powers.
Working with industry-specific and high complex precision machines including but not limited to: ball mills, ID fans, lube oil skids, turbines. Conveyors, generators, hydraulic systems, pumps, gears, dry gas seals, mechanical seals, bearings, compressors.
Use precision leveling and alignment tools to measure angles, material thickness and small distances with calipers, squares, micrometers, optical instruments and other tools.
